WebThe Marginal Rate of Substitution is the amount of of a good that has to be given up to obtain an additional unit of another good while keeping the satisfaction the same. As some amount of a good has to be sacrificed for an additional unit of another good it is the Opportunity Cost. The MRS is basically a way of mathematically representing the ... WebIn Fig. 2.12, IC 1, IC 2 and IC 3 are the three indifference curves and AB is the budget line. With the constraint of budget line, the highest indifference curve, which a consumer can reach, is IC 2. The budget line is tangent to indifference curve IC 2 at point ‘E’. WebMar 21, 2024 · An indifference curve shows combinations of goods and services between which a consumer is indifferent. In other words, each combination on an indifference curve gives the consumer the same total satisfaction. An indifference curve is normally drawn as convex to the origin. WebA budget line shows the combination of goods that can be afforded with your current income. If an apple costs £1 and a banana £2, the above budget line shows all the combinations of the goods which can be bought with £40. Lilly’s preferences are shown by the indifference curves. Lilly’s budget constraint, given the prices of books and doughnuts and her income, is shown by the straight line. Lilly’s optimal choice will be point B, where the budget line is tangent to the indifference curve Um.
